最近,AI相关技术在业界越来越受欢迎。从创造机械化的游戏资源到帮助开发者创造创意,技术的进步总是让人目不暇接。不过,或许在未来的某一天,编写AI技术的游戏开发者甚至程序员也有可能被自己创造的机器人所取代。近日,海外开发者Mathy透露,OpenAI创建的GPT-3模型甚至可以帮你写代码。其他作家表示,未来人工智能可能比人类更懂得如何搭讪。人工智能取代程序员?GPT-3已经可以编写简单的代码。OpenAI的语言模型GPT-3以其灵活性得到了很多人的认可,并被用于AI写博客、识别标题简单的画作等诸多任务中。据程序??员IvanMathy介绍,在最新的开发中,语言模型甚至被用于编写游戏代码,“你只需要描述你想要的东西,GPT-3会尝试用UnityC#脚本写下来。”不久前,同样的语言模型被训练用来与人对话。令人惊讶的是,机器写出的文字并不像人们想象的那么生硬。例如,其中一个句子说:“我摘了一些美丽的花,你想闻一闻吗?请把我的手拿开。”从略显幼稚的调情,到创造效率惊人的游戏代码,GPT-3已经向我们证明,虽然它的技能只是本文创造的基本逻辑,但它仍然有能力创造出一些独特的东西。简单是最好的,根据Mathy的说法,用简单的语言编写的指令以及直接明确的指令是最成功的。例如,GPT-3可以执行命令“创建一个脚本,以正弦运动左右移动游戏对象,速度和振幅作为参数”。这句话听起来单调,但AI会理解并据此编写代码。它可能还不能创建完整的游戏,但程序员已经在想象GPT-3是否可以帮助他们进行游戏,为NPC角色创建对话和聊天。一般来说,这些角色并没有那么复杂,但或许借助GPT-3的“超过1750亿参数的语言模型”,开发者或许可以创造出更深层次的对话。机器人可以玩游戏还有很长的路要走。不过,对于Mathy提供的AI生成游戏代码,Reddit用户BaguetteTourEiffel给出了更为批判的看法,“GPT-3越来越累了,对于不知道的人来说,这是一个巨大的(不可运行的)在任何计算机上)训练大量数据的神经网络。”诚然,GPT-3模型本身并不能“理解”数据,但它解析大量数据和生成连贯代码的能力仍然令人印象深刻。Mathy还希望程序员尝试这项技术,“如果你有OpenAI借口密钥,你可以通过在一行代码中提示‘使用Unity引擎’来自己尝试,这相当于告诉GPT-3它正在寻找一行代码,然后它会尝试为您完成剩下的工作。”GPT-3在构建完整游戏之前可能还有很长的路要走,但我们不应该忽视它已经完成的工作。即使在十年前,这种人工智能自动化能力几乎是不可能的。那么,10年后,谁知道会发生什么?只是希望它不会带走你的工作。OpenAI的语言模型GPT-3曾经是一种供人们取乐的技术,现在越来越受到人们的喜爱。AI研究人员兼作家JanelleShane决定训练模型以创建她自己的对话方式,幸运的是,结果很奇怪,并没有人们想象的那么糟糕。老实说,我们需要提高我们的水平。模特的搭讪包括非常天真可爱的话语,例如“我爱你,不在乎你是不是穿大衣的狗”。没什么意义,但总比那种尴尬的“你迷路了吗,女士?因为天堂离这里很远”好。2017年,Shane在同一主题上运行了另一个模型,得到了类似“你很漂亮,你知道我的意思”之类的话语。Shane使用了四种不同的GPT-3模型,最大的DaVinci是“最现代”的模型,这意味着它可以生成有意义的句子。比如,“你的脸很可爱,我可以把它放在我的空气清新剂上吗?因为我想带走你的味道。”其他人包括,“你知道我喜欢你什么吗?你的大长腿,”和“我曾经和一个非常想念你的人一起工作,他是一个有家庭的正常人,你也是一个家庭人。”普通人?”这听起来可能很主观,但实际上非常好。Shane承认她出于荒谬的原因避免训练GPT-3,这提高了效率。“我拒绝再次尝试神经网络方法,因为能力更强意味着他们”更像人,这实际上很糟糕。还有新的神经网络只是复制现有的产品,这也很糟糕。”她补充说,“人类对拾取技能的描述非常糟糕”。
